谷歌的"网络平台"是如何有别于其他的呢?
发布者:Martin LaMonica
5月,谷歌将举行名为谷歌I/O(Google I/O)的开发者研讨会,为的是讨论[在给网页编写应用程序]时所面临的挑战。
今年在美国旧金山所举行的、为期两天的会议活动,其规模超过去年谷歌所举办的[开发者日活动],这是第一次专门针对网页开发人员而举办的会议。
但是,其形式却有所不同――此次会议,将更加对技术层面进行的深入探讨,并且会为那些有志于编写mash-ups(混搭应用技术)的新手提供技术指导――谷歌的研发者策略继续保持不变。
为何他们想要吸引研发者?为了鼓励创造更多更好的网页应用程序。――一位谷歌资深产品经理,Tom Stocky,在星期二如是说。
"大体上说啦,我们试图获得更多的用户。我们希望增加用户数量以及他们使用网页的数值。我们发现,改良网络平台是为达到这一点的最好的方式。"Stocky说道。
今年的不同之处在于:我们将增加[对于社会应用性]方面的关注,以及思考网页的总体发展。谷歌在关于[社会应用性]方面的会议上,包括如何使用OpenSocial,其目的是让人们在[有不同应用之间的社会网络]上,共享信息。
这儿还有一个灵活的发展渠道,包括如何使用Google Gears for Mobile以及Android――谷歌移动电话平台和其合作伙伴去年11月介绍说。
所有的[网络平台]都是一样的么?
谷歌,当然,其并不是吸引网络开发者的唯一高科技公司。
"Salesforce.com"在[对客户关系的管理应用]的方面订购销售。但是当你和公司首席执行官Marc Benioff聊过之后,你很快就能明白,他正在考虑公司的发展平台,其名为"Force.com",并将在未来增长壮大。
其他的一些网络巨头――Yahoo,eBay,以及Amazon――都拥有自己的开发计划。
然而,在网页服务方面革新最多的公司,是微软(Microsoft),它刚刚主办了自己的[混合网络开发会议](Mix Web development conference)
在其网页服务方面,它已经有了很多应用编程接口(APIs),从Virtual Earth到Windows Live Messenger,并且还将会允许更多的接口。
"我们没有一个作为销售的基本平台。我们正努力改善网页,使它能够作为一个平台...并且作为一个整体而言,我们还将增加互联网的用法。"
――Tom Stocky,谷歌资深产品经理。
更为重要的是,微软了解[平台],知道如何建立一个成功的[应用程序以及合作伙伴、如何让人人都能参与赚钱]三方面"生态体系"。
微软公司首席软件设计师Ray Ozzie已经制定了一个远景目标,为广泛的应用程序提供统一的发展模式。从传统客户服务器的Windows应用程序,到使用Silverlight浏览器的mashups应用程序的网页服务。
就技术层面而言,谷歌所推出的用来吸引开发商的网站与其他网站相比,略有不同。
Stcoky说,谷歌tool和APIs的重点,是Java Script以及良好的开发Ajax业务。
当然,谷歌没有一个传统意义上的商业工具――像微软(Microsoft)或者Adobe所做的那样――那样的话,需要重新安装给互联网"cloud"编写的应用程序。
此外,谷歌希望升级[在所有浏览器都能够运行]的技术,而不是像Flash或者Silverlight那样,需要特殊的插件和所有权才能运行。
"如果有人想要推进网络的未来,我们希望他们能够做到让人人都获利的这一点,"Stocky说道,"我们没有一个作为销售的基本平台。我们正努力改善网页,使它能够作为一个平台...并且作为一个整体而言,我们还将增加互联网的用法。"
谷歌自己的工程师能够扩展Ajax的界限。其首次发布谷歌地图,在那儿用户能够在浏览器周围托拽地图,并且启发更多的研发人员拓展Webware的临界点。
Stocky说,Google I/O的目标之一,就是收集研发者所遇到的网页临界点的反馈。但是已经明确的一点是,谷歌希望继续前进下去――并且推动――更多有利于Web应用程序的势头。
"总体上来说,我所认识的每一个研发者都努力学习更多的关于[JavaScript和Ajax技术]的最佳做法,"他说道,"这正是我们编制程序的方向。"
评论